This is just one example of the false advertisement of serving sizes in the fast food industry. I have repeatedly been ripped off by multiple Burger King Stores when ordering french toast sticks during breakfast. I usually get a three piece order of the french toast sticks (which costs a dollar) and almost every time I'm only given 2 1/2 sticks. Sure this isn't causing a huge money loss to me but i expect to at least be given the amount of food that i am paying for!
